Rosh Lowe has been covering news for nearly two decades in South Florida.
He is known for breaking exclusive stories and has covered nearly every major news story in the market. He was the recipient of the 2013 Miami New Times Best TV News reporter of the year.
He started his career at WFTX in Fort Myers and spent 17 years at WSVN in Miami. He was thrilled to join the One and Only Local 10 News in 2021.
Rosh is an avid runner and grew up as a child actor where he performed in three Broadway shows. He is a proud father of four.
